The City of Lakes

Pokhara is a picturesque city located in central Nepal, known for its stunning natural beauty and adventure opportunities. The city lies along the banks of the tranquil Phewa Lake, offering breathtaking views of the surrounding mountains, particularly the towering Annapurna range and the iconic Machhapuchhre, also known as the "Fishtail" mountain.

Kandy

14Kandy

UNESCO World Heritage Site in Sri Lanka

Amidst tea and spice plantations of Sri Lanka, Kandy showcases remnants of its colonial past and affords spectacular lush landscapes and a rich Buddhist cultural heritage.

Busan

15Busan

Busan - The Coastal Gem of South Korea

Busan, South Korea's vibrant coastal city, boasts a perfect blend of stunning beaches, bustling nightlife, and rich cultural experiences. Visitors can explore the colourful Gamcheon Culture Village, relax on the pristine Haeundae Beach, and indulge in mouth-watering local cuisine at the lively Jagalchi Fish Market.

Why is it recommended to travel in the month of October?

Most of the Indian cities experience pleasant weather in October. Autumn is at its peak this month. As a result, the weather is neither too hot nor too cold. October is also the month of festivities. All these make the season apt for planning your vacation. Tourist destinations like Delhi, Agra, Jaipur, Jaisalmer, Jodhpur, Udaipur, Indore, Bhopal, Sanchi, Nainital, Amritsar, Chandigarh, Shimla, Manali and Kasol are the top places to visit in October.
